Output 8db60345f6a7aff0a924e3e016e7c9917b17fc27eb75de59fba662dc81ff8dfe:1

value
2852034
script pubkey
OP_HASH160 OP_PUSHBYTES_20 d6e70dd62306def8c69a46f26f91a766ce390342 OP_EQUAL
address
3MHKKWfLVUHGXovFXrBxH5hbFrVavjgnr8
transaction
8db60345f6a7aff0a924e3e016e7c9917b17fc27eb75de59fba662dc81ff8dfe
spent
true